In this role, you will:
Independently design, implement, and manage secure, highly available HashiCorp Vault platform with minimal oversight from lead engineers.
Contribute to end-to-end automation of Vault provisioning, configuration, and lifecycle management using Ansible and Terraform
Develop and enforce platform standards for secrets management, authentication, authorization, and Vault best practices across the organization.
Analyze and solve complex technical challenges, including cloud native and multi-cloud integrations, Kubernetes auth setups, PKI hierarchies, replication, and performance optimization.
Collaborate directly with cross-functional teams—security, platform engineering, application teams, product owners, and vendors—to deliver architecturally sound Vault solutions.
Troubleshoot deep technical issues independently, including HA failures, unseal workflows, auth method problems, and secret engine configuration errors.
Implement advanced Vault capabilities, such as static and dynamic secrets, PKI secret engine, dynamic Database secrets, and namespace management.
Guide and support engineering teams, providing Vault expertise, technical recommendations, and onboarding assistance without requiring constant supervision.
Drive continuous improvement, identifying opportunities for automation, performance tuning, reliability enhancements, and security hardening across Vault deployments.
Provide on-call support on rotational basis per team’s schedule.
